Mnet Plus gains popularity with global Gen Z and Gen Alpha K-pop lovers through its ‘fanteractive’ offerings

Marking its 30th anniversary in the cultural business, CJ ENM has unveiled a new growth vision for the worldwide K-pop industry through its global content platform Mnet Plus.
Positioning Mnet Plus as a core hub that seamlessly connects content, fandom and business, CJ ENM announced its ambition to evolve the platform into an all-in-one “fanteractive” (fan + interactive) platform designed for the global Gen Z and Gen Alpha generations.
Under the theme “Capturing the Gen Zalpha Generation: Mnet Plus Rises as a Global Platform,” CJ ENM hosted a CULTURE TALK event on October 28 at its Sangam-dong headquarters in Seoul, where the company shared its vision and key achievements.

Surpassing 40 Million Subscribers — Emerging as a Global K-pop Content Hub
Building on CJ ENM’s three decades of expertise in music production and platform operations, Mnet Plus has grown rapidly as a global K-pop content hub. In just three years since its launch, the platform has surpassed 40 million app users, including 20 million monthly active users (MAU) and 7.62 million daily active users (DAU). Notably, about 80% of total traffic comes from overseas users, signaling growing popularity among the global Gen Z and Gen Alpha generations.
“SUMBAKKOKJIL,” “The City of Spy: NCT 127” and other original variety shows, along with Mnet broadcast shows, concerts, KCON and the MAMA AWARDS, are all available for streaming and on-demand viewing through Mnet Plus, which has built an expansive library and solidified its position as a global K-pop hub. The platform has also advanced its fanteractive features — including voting, fan support, live streaming and real-time “TALK” — to heighten user engagement. As a result, total views this year have exceeded 130 million, and during the live finale of “Boys II Planet,” engagement peaked at more than 70,000 votes per second, demonstrating the passionate participation of its global fandom.

From ‘Viewing’ to ‘Experiencing’ — a Platform for Everything K-pop
CJ ENM plans to further evolve Mnet Plus into an all-in-one fanteractive platform in which viewing, participation and consumption take place seamlessly in one space. The goal is to create an environment in which casual fans can grow into dedicated supporters, and core fandoms can enjoy a deeper, more immersive K-pop experience.
“Beyond simply watching K-pop content, we want K-pop lovers to discover the value of a true ‘experience platform’ — one that allows fans to directly participate and fully immerse themselves in the world of K-pop,” stated Kim Jiwon, Senior Vice President of Mnet Plus.

Going forward, Mnet Plus plans to strengthen its platform competitiveness through three key pillars: expanding a diverse lineup of original K-pop content, enhancing global streaming services and reinforcing the fandom value chain. To broaden fan choices, the platform will also introduce an ad-supported free viewing model to ensure accessibility for all users, while deepening engagement through premium content offerings — ultimately building a positive cycle that connects fans, artists and brands.
“In the K-pop industry, platforms are the core drivers of growth. What matters now is the kind of value and experience they deliver,” emphasized Cha Woojin, founder of Enter Culture Lab. “Platforms must go beyond deepening fandoms — they should also expand the breadth of K-pop culture enjoyed by fans worldwide.”
